IMAGING PIPELINE PROCESSING

    Abstract: A method of processing data in a multi-stage imaging pipeline, the method comprising, at each stage of the multi-stage imaging pipeline, identifying a plurality of encoding values represented in received input data in a given encoding space for the respective pipeline stage, the identified plurality of encoding values comprising a subset of encoded values which are capable of being represented in the given encoding space, generating a list of encoding indices corresponding to the identified plurality of encoded values in the given encoding space, representing the encodings of one or more entities of the received input data using the generated list of encoding indices, and outputting the represented encodings of the one or more entities to the next stage of the multi-stage imaging pipeline.

    GENERATING PREVIEWS OF 3D OBJECTS

    Abstract: Methods and apparatus relating to previews of objects are described. In one example, control data for generating a three-dimensional object specifying, for voxels of the object, at least one print material to be deposited in that voxel during object generation is obtained. A viewing frustum may be determined, and visible voxels within the viewing frustum identified. A number of preview display pixels to display the preview may be determined and the set of voxels to be represented by each preview display pixel identified. At least one voxel appearance parameter of a voxel may be determined from the control data. For each preview display pixel, at least one pixel appearance parameter may be determined by combining voxel appearance parameters for the set of voxels to be represented by that preview display pixel. Preview display pixels may be controlled to display a preview of the object according to the at least one pixel appearance parameter.
